Perioperative Management of a Girl with Hemophilia B Undergoing Dorsolumbar Spi...

Martinho, L; Câmara, L; Batalha, S; Rodrigues, J; Carioca, F; Marques, J

Hemophilia B is a coagulation disorder characterized by a deficiency of clotting factor IX. Women are often heterozygous carriers of the disease, however if their clotting factor levels are less than 60%, they may have an increased bleeding tendency. This is even higher if levels are under 40%. We presente a case of a 14-year-old female, with mild hemofilia B (hemofilia B carrier with factor IX level < 40%) who...
